Alan Greenspan, who died Monday on the age of 100, presided over a two-decade-long period of nearly unprecedented American boom and financial dominance that’s now inaptly known as “The Great Moderation.” 

His long tenure as chairman of the Federal Reserve Board affords invaluable financial classes that right this moment’s Fed can be clever to heed.

President Ronald Reagan nominated Greenspan as Fed chair in 1987, during his second White House time period. 

There Greenspan remained till 2006, reappointed by President Bill Clinton and staying by way of a lot of George W. Bush’s presidency.

His tenure adopted a period of turbulent and typically reckless financial coverage on the Fed. 

In the tumultuous Seventies, the Fed tried to juice a floundering economic system with straightforward money, pushing inflation to as high as 11% on the eve of the Reagan presidency. 

Family incomes crashed in actual phrases as Americans’ after-inflation incomes shrank.

It was the worst decade for the US economic system because the Great Depression, sending the stock market into an prolonged stoop.

Greenspan’s rapid predecessor on the Fed, Paul Volker, is rightly credited with breaking the back of double-digit inflation by taking away the “punchbowl” of straightforward money.

That helped launch a 40-year bull market on Wall Street and speedy positive factors in American GDP.

But it was Greenspan who solidified the longer-term victory over inflation, and completely restored international confidence within the greenback. 

During his reign inflation averaged between 2% and 3%. 

He operated underneath the “Volcker rule,” utilizing commodity costs as a forward-looking gauge of inflation to keep costs steady.  

And it labored magnificently. 

The Reagan growth that started in late 1982 hit a velocity bump with the mini-stock market crash of 1987, however the restoration was swift — and within the Nineties and early 2000s, the economic system shot up like an Elon Musk rocket.

So did the stock market: If you put $100 into S&P 500 shares when Greenspan arrived, that investment was price more than $900 on his departure 19 years later.

So did household incomes: America turned a job-creation machine during Greenspan’s tenure, including roughly 2 million new jobs on average yearly.

But at the same time as growth exploded, Greenspan was ever vigilant towards stock-market bubbles.

In one of his most well-known speeches, he memorably warned traders in 1996 to beware “irrational exuberance,” fearing that stock values could have been getting forward of themselves. 

Yet the market continued to soar as America got here to dominate the web age, with corporations like Apple, Amazon and Google main the charge — and Greenspan’s low rates of interest facilitating the boom.

Greenspan — as soon as an avid follower of the well-known libertarian Ayn Rand — wasn’t simply an inflation hawk; he additionally used the Fed’s bully pulpit to browbeat Congress into chopping deficit spending. 

It’s no accident that the one balanced budgets within the final 50 years occurred when Greenspan was on the helm of the Fed.   

That’s the lesson of the Greenspan period: Combine steady costs, decrease tax charges, and much less regulation with restraints on authorities spending, and you’ve acquired the key sauce for a affluent America. 

The greenback turned the unmatched world reserve currency within the Nineties, and different nations successfully “dollarized” their own currencies to defeat the curse and theft of runaway inflation. 

One of the nations that correctly dollarized was China, during its speedy ascent after shifting away from a wholly communist economic system towards a market-oriented one. 

Inflation remained low till in 2022 Fed chief Jerome Powell allowed costs to flare up to above 9% during Joe Biden’s presidency.   

It’s ironic that many financial historians have begun to call the Greenspan period “The Great Moderation”  — as a result of all that was actually “moderate” during this period was inflation. 

In reality, it was the “Great American Boom,” underneath rules that President Donald Trump is restoring.

Kevin Warsh, the new Fed chair, seems to be a disciple of Volcker and Greenspan, regularly touting the coverage of a steady greenback

If he follows their instance, more prosperity is correct across the nook.
